Why Bruce goes so fast
We have found it difficult to fit in any long rides lately and so have been doing laps of our old standy-by route -the Kew Boulevard. This is a favorite haunt for cyclists because it offers the following : 1. road riding 2. proximity to the city 3. minimal traffic and 4. .... a few hills ! Yes , the hills are a necessary form of masochism in our training regime. Each complete lap of the Boulevard is 14 km, which takes us around 35 mins (B) or more (K!) ... and longer if we stop for coffee at either Studley Park Boathouse, Fairfield Boathouse or even The Boulevard Restaurant.... yes - choice of three cafes - that is the real reason it is Bruce's favourite ride! .. and also the reason he goes so fast on the "Last lap before coffee".
